Transaction d6dd6f623937aa3a94cebbfd66464776b6ebf80b037770c12b518497b33a8ab5
1 Input
1 Output
-
d6dd6f623937aa3a94cebbfd66464776b6ebf80b037770c12b518497b33a8ab5:0
- value
- 4364692
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c569218dbc3d635c38ad4aa8119913982d0b354 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16W3FYiv7D9z7fP8V6Bik5Tfr4SrxcpB2j